Seeing the Light

The truth is contained in the Bible - the Word of God - but it is not easy to discover or to understand.

As an American, I was educated to believe that man is essentially good and that education will bring men to happiness, prosperity, and peace. What Christians called “sin?I believed was ignorance—and curable. My desire was to help change society; religion seemed irrelevant.

Finished with school and working in the world, I found that my philosophy did not fit the facts. As a college English teacher, I had to help students understand literature that frequently made reference to the Old and New Testaments. I would research individual passages, but their deeper significance was elusive and the basic intention of the Bible a mystery.

How I thank the Lord that at the age of 38 I was introduced to the ministry of Watchman Nee and Witness Lee. They made the Bible so clear to me, not in a general way, but in every detail: God’s heart’s desire, man’s fall and redemption, man’s regeneration and growth in the divine life. The pieces of the Bible came together, and I began to experience Christ working His will in me, not by my efforts, but by His operation within.

I have been enjoying this ministry now for 36 years, realizing the truth of these lines from a wonderful hymn, “The Lord hath yet more light and truth/ To break forth from His Word.?(Hymns, 817)

W. G.
